According to the pharmokenetics section of Rxlist.Risperidone is an antipsychotic agent belonging to a new chemical class, the benzisoxazole derivatives. The chemical designation is 3-[2-[4-(6-fluoro-1,2-benzisoxazol-3-yl)-1 -piperidinyl]ethyl]-6,7,8,9-tetrahydro-2-methyl-4H-pyrido[1 ,2-a]pyrimidin-4-one. Its molecular formula is C23H27FN4O2 and its molecular weight is 410.49.
